TL;DR Summary

Jim Gordon, the drummer who played on "Layla" and "Pet Sounds," has died at the age of 77 in a California medical facility. Gordon was diagnosed with schizophrenia and was serving a prison sentence for killing his mother in 1983. He was a member of the Wrecking Crew and played on recordings by John Lennon, Cher, and many others. Gordon shared a songwriting credit on "Layla" with Eric Clapton, and was responsible for the song's famous piano coda.
